If you or someone you know needs help, please reach out to these resources:
- SAMHSA’s National Helpline: 1-800-662-HELP (4357) - A confidential, free, 24/7 information service, in English and Spanish, providing referrals to local treatment facilities, support groups, and community-based organizations. https://www.samhsa.gov/find-help/national-helpline
- National Institute on Drug Abuse (NIDA): https://www.drugabuse.gov/ - Provides comprehensive information on drug abuse and addiction.
- Alcoholics Anonymous (AA): https://www.aa.org/ - A fellowship of men and women who share their experience, strength, and hope with each other that they may solve their common problem and help others to recover from alcoholism.
- Narcotics Anonymous (NA): https://www.na.org/ - A non-profit, international, peer-support group for individuals recovering from drug addiction.
- Crisis Text Line: Text HOME to 741741 – Free, 24/7 crisis support via text message.

Accessing Mental Health & Substance Use Support
Feeling overwhelmed by emotional challenges or struggling with dependency? Don't hesitate to seek assistance. The SAMHSA National Helpline provides a vital service: a no-cost and discreet information service available around the clock in both English and Spanish language. You can connect with them by calling 1-800-662-HELP (4357). They is designed to help both those and families confronting mental health disorders and/or addiction problems. Discover more about their services at [https://www.samhsa.gov/find-help/national-helpline](https://www.samhsa.gov/find-help/national-helpline). Keep in mind that you are not alone; assistance is readily obtainable.
